Choline deficiency causes hepatic steatosis (fatty liver) in over 50% of patients who require long-term parenteral nutrition. The purpose of this study is to determine if the addition of choline chloride to intravenous (received via a vein) nutrition solutions (TPN) can treat low levels of choline in the body (choline deficiency) or hepatic steatosis (fatty liver) associated with long-term use of TPN. Choline chloride is a research or investigational drug and is approved by the FDA only for use in studies such as this one.
